Setting up high-speed synchronisation HSS
Faster shutter speeds than the flash sync speed of the camera could be used for
flashing with high-speed synchronisation HSS. To use high-speed
synchronisation HSS, the camera must support this function. To find out
whether your camera and flash devices support high-speed synchronisation,
read their respective instruction manuals.
To switch from normal synchronisation
(2) to high speed
synchronisation HSS, press button (1).
Symbol
(3) appears on the screen page to show high-speed synchronisation
HSS.
